Python文件下载实战教程步骤解析与高效方法分享

1942920 电脑软件 2025-05-30 3 0

作为一种高效、易读且功能强大的编程语言,Python已成为全球开发者的首选工具。无论是数据分析、人工智能、Web开发还是自动化脚本,Python都能以其简洁的语法和丰富的生态系统满足需求。本文将从初学者角度出发,系统讲解Python的核心功能、版本选择策略以及官方下载与安装的全流程,帮助读者快速掌握这一工具的使用方法,并为后续开发打下坚实基础。

一、Python的核心功能与应用场景

Python文件下载实战教程步骤解析与高效方法分享

Python的设计哲学强调代码可读性和开发效率,其功能覆盖多个领域:

1. Web开发:借助Django、Flask等框架快速构建后端服务;

2. 数据科学与机器学习:通过NumPy、Pandas、TensorFlow等库处理海量数据;

3. 自动化运维:编写脚本实现文件管理、系统监控等任务;

4. 跨平台兼容性:支持Windows、macOS、Linux系统无缝运行。

其强大的第三方库生态使开发者无需重复造轮子,直接调用现成模块即可实现复杂功能。

二、Python的版本选择策略

Python文件下载实战教程步骤解析与高效方法分享

(1)主版本差异

  • Python 2与Python 3:Python 2已于2020年停止维护,官方强烈建议选择Python 3系列(如2025年主流版本3.11及以上)以获得最新功能和安全更新。
  • 稳定性优先:官网提供稳定版(Stable Releases)和测试版(Pre-releases),推荐下载标记为“Stable”的版本以避免兼容性问题。
  • (2)系统适配原则

    Python文件下载实战教程步骤解析与高效方法分享

  • 操作系统匹配:Windows用户下载`.exe`安装包,macOS选择“macOS 64-bit”版本,Linux用户可通过源码编译或包管理器安装。
  • 位数选择:32位系统需下载“x86”版本,64位系统选择“x86-64”。可通过系统设置查看本机位数。
  • 三、官网下载全流程指南

    步骤1:访问Python官方网站

    打开浏览器输入官网地址 ,点击导航栏的 “Downloads” 按钮。页面将自动检测操作系统并推荐对应版本,也可手动选择其他系统。

    步骤2:选择安装包类型

  • Windows用户:优先下载 Windows Installer (64-bit/32-bit),此类安装包包含完整环境并支持自动配置系统变量。
  • 进阶选项
  • Executable Installer:离线安装包,适合网络不稳定场景;
  • Web-based Installer:仅包含基础组件,安装时需联网下载依赖;
  • Embeddable Zip File:绿色压缩版,需手动配置环境变量。
  • 步骤3:获取历史版本

    如需特定版本(如兼容旧项目),进入 “Downloads” → “All releases”,在归档页面找到目标版本号和对应的安装包链接。

    四、安装过程中的关键设置

    (1)环境变量配置

    安装向导中务必勾选 “Add Python to PATH” 选项(Windows)或通过终端手动添加路径(macOS/Linux),确保命令行可直接调用`python`命令。

    (2)自定义安装选项

  • 组件选择:建议勾选 pip(包管理工具)、IDLE(集成开发环境)和 tkinter(GUI库);
  • 安装路径:默认路径为`C:PythonXX`(Windows)或`/usr/local/bin`(macOS/Linux),可修改至自定义目录以节省系统盘空间。
  • (3)多版本共存管理

    若需同时使用多个Python版本,安装时取消勾选 “Register as default”,后续通过`py -3.11`或`python3.11`命令指定版本运行。

    五、安装后的验证与测试

    (1)基础验证

    打开终端或命令提示符,输入以下命令:

    bash

    python version

    若显示类似 “Python 3.11.5” 的版本号,则表明安装成功。

    (2)运行首个程序

    使用文本编辑器创建`hello.py`文件,写入代码:

    python

    print("Hello, World!")

    在终端执行:

    bash

    python hello.py

    成功输出即表示环境配置完成。

    (3)包管理器测试

    输入`pip list`查看已安装的第三方库,尝试安装新库如:

    bash

    pip install requests

    若无报错,则证明pip功能正常。

    六、常见问题与解决方案

    1. 安装失败提示权限不足:以管理员身份运行安装程序(Windows)或使用`sudo`命令(macOS/Linux)。

    2. 命令行无法识别Python命令:检查环境变量是否包含Python安装路径,或重新安装并勾选PATH选项。

    3. 版本冲突导致程序异常:使用虚拟环境工具(如`venv`)隔离不同项目的依赖。

    七、Python的应用生态扩展

    完成基础安装后,可通过以下工具提升开发效率:

  • IDE推荐:PyCharm(专业开发)、VS Code(轻量级编辑)、Jupyter Notebook(交互式数据分析);
  • 虚拟环境管理:通过`conda`或`virtualenv`创建独立环境;
  • 第三方库安装:使用`pip install`命令获取超过40万个开源库支持。
  • 通过以上步骤,您已成功搭建Python开发环境。接下来可探索官方文档、参与开源项目或学习框架应用,逐步解锁Python在各领域的潜力。